Vice President JD Vance postponed a planned trip to Switzerland for the first technical negotiations over President Trump’s preliminary U.S.-Iran agreement, and Switzerland said the Friday meeting at Bürgenstock would not go ahead as scheduled. A White House spokesperson said plans for the talks had not been finalized, citing difficult logistics and saying the U.S. delegation remained prepared to depart at the first available opportunity.
